Glad Plant in Amherst re-opening After Coronavirus Cases, Deep Cleaning

AMHERST Co., Va. (WSET) -- The Glad Manufacturing Company in Amherst will open a couple days early after voluntarily suspending operations due to COVID-19.

The company said it was voluntarily suspending operations for 14 days on March 21 after they said two employees reported as positive for coronavirus.

The Virginia Department of Health confirms that there are three cases of coronavirus in Amherst, but did not connect those cases to the Glad Manufacturing Company. As of Monday, March 30, there were 1,020 cases, 136 hospitalizations, and 25 deaths in Virginia.

Glad said they announced plans to reopen on April 1, which is two days shy of the full two week suspension.
